The Fiji womens 7's team has booked a gold medal play-off match against Samoa in the Pacific Games tomorrow.

Fiji defeated New Caledonia 55-7 then thumped Guam 71-0 before ending with a 43-0 win against Tahiti.

Also booking a place in the quarterfinal is the men's team after defeating Tahiti 45-0.

Meanwhile Fiji thrashed Tokelau 77-0 in their last pool game this afternoon and has qualified for the semi-final stages

The Fiji Men's Basketball team will be out to maintain their winning streak against PNG at 8pm to keep their gold defence campaign on track.

The latest medal tally has Fiji in 3rd spot with 7 gold, 4 silver and 13 bronze.

New Caledonia remains in the lead with 28 gold, 27 silver and 5 bronze medals.

Tahiti follows in second place with 14 gold, 5 silver and 7 bronze medals.
